Document Highlights:
The Canadian economy is expected to expand by 2.0 per cent this year and 1.9 per cent in 2019. That is similar to what the forecasters were projecting in the spring survey.
While the outlook for export growth has improved somewhat, concerns about the trade war are still hurting the forecast.
Consumer prices are expected to increase by 2.4 per cent this year, up from the 2.0 per cent gain anticipated in the winter survey.
